“Tom Myers – Technique Series: Functional Lines” is an advanced course focusing on the functional lines concept within myofascial therapy, developed by Tom Myers. Participants will learn detailed anatomical insights and specialized techniques to assess and treat myofascial connections that influence functional movement patterns. The course aims to enhance practitioners’ skills in applying targeted therapeutic strategies to improve mobility, reduce pain, and optimize overall physical function based on the functional lines framework.
Fascial Plane and Myofascial Release Techniques presented as an integrated series of techniques for each of the Anatomy Trains lines! There are eight videos, which ‘illustrate’ Chapters 3 through 9 of the Anatomy Trains book. The techniques are demonstrated by Tom in a small-class, mentoring-type situation, with the student’s questions, Tom’s corrections, and client feedback all contributing to your being able to apply these techniques with ease and confidence. As in Chapter 8, this program presents integrated manual and movement techniques for easing, strengthening, and repositioning the Functional Lines that join the contralateral shoulder and hip, applicable to sports-related applications
